Louis MAJORELLE (1859-1926) and DAUM in Nancy Table lamp model "Water lily" with base in ormolu ornamented with a base of three frogs in the round on a background of stylized leaves from which three leafy branches emerge of water lilies. Three-lobed glass corolla dish acid-etched and recut with leaf decoration of water lilies in shades of yellow-orange. Signed Daum on the cup and L. Majorelle on the foot. H. 69 cm. Similar models listed in : - Catalogue of the Ecole de Nancy à l'Union Centrale des Arts Décoratifs, Pavilion de Marsan, Paris 1903. - Louis Majorelle by Alastair Duncan, Ed. Thames and Hudson, London 1991 page 134 - The Ecole de Nancy, 1889-1909, RMN 1999 page 331 - Daum 1878-1939 A Lorraine Art Industry by C. Bardin, Metz 2004 page 303 A model of this lamp appears in the collections of the Musée d'Orsay with a naturalist frame on which the frogs are absent. In 1890, Louis Majorelle opened a workshop in the city of Paris. dedicated to metal work, and the collaboration between the two houses Majorelle and Daum started in 1903 on the occasion of of the execution of this lamp.
